What are The Sox trying to do with Lowell and his $12M after signing Beltre to play 3B for $10M?
Has anybody heard anything? |
|
#3
|
||||
|
||||
|
The conventional wisdom in Red Sox Nation regarding Mike Lowell is that since he has passed the "healthy threshold" in the off-season, once he demonstrates in Spring training that he can still move sufficiently well defensively he will be attractive enough for the Red Sox to secure the trade deal the team was unable to complete with the Rangers.
Beltre is a great acquisition, but Lowell will be sorely missed. He is a fan favorite, a genuinely good guy, and a tremendous clutch performer. |

Thnx.
Will The Sox have to eat any of that $12M or will TEX pay it all? |
|
#5
|
||||
|
||||
|
I should have written "a trade deal, which the team was unable to complete with the Rangers." That deal fell apart; there is no deal within which the Red Sox would have to eat part of Lowell's salary on behalf of the Rangers. I would suspect that they will have to do so with some other team, though. I doubt the Rangers will revive the original trade.
